WebbSimple problems are ones like baking a cake from a mix. Success comes from following the recipe. Complicated problems are ones like sending a rocket to the moon. Sometimes we can break them down into a series of simple problems. But this is not always the case. Success often takes multiple people, multiple teams, and specialized expertise.
